Key Strategies: DRSABCD Framework

One critical facet instructed in infant first aid courses is the DRSABCD structure:

D-- Danger: Look for any risk to yourself or others. R-- Feedback: Analyze if the baby reacts by delicately trembling their shoulders or calling their name. S-- Send out for Help: Call emergency solutions instantly if there's no response. A-- Respiratory tract: Open the respiratory tract using a head tilt-chin lift technique. B-- Breathing: Check for normal breathing patterns within 10 seconds. C-- Compressions: Otherwise breathing usually, commence upper body compressions promptly at a rate of 100-120 compressions per minute. D-- Defibrillation: Make use of an AED if offered once qualified personnel arrive.

This systematic approach streamlines emergency reactions and ensures clarity during high-stress situations.

Baby Proofing Your Home as Part of Emergency Preparedness

While not directly component of official training sessions used throughout programs like HLTAID011 (Supply First Aid), making your home safe plays a necessary first aid training ballarat duty also! Below are some tips:

Install safety and security locks on cupboards including unsafe materials (cleaners/medications). Use corner protectors on furniture sides where babies could crawl or stroll unsteadily-- prevention reduces accidents! Keep small products out-of-reach that position choking risks-- like coins or buttons!
